Abstract

In a method, a printing system and a computer program for trapping of print data with a plurality of objects, the print data are generated, prepared and/or transferred together with trapping instructions in a print data stream for execution of the trapping. The print data stream references resource data that comprise trapping parameters and/or trapping instructions. The method can be executed in real time without a delay in the printing process hereby occurring. It can therefore be integrated into a print data stream for electrographic high-capacity printers.
